Q: Is 2,295,007 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,295,007 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2295007 can be evenly divided by 1 11 13 121 143 1,459 1,573 16,049 18,967 176,539 208,637 and 2,295,007, with no remainder.
Since 2,295,007 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,295,007, it is not a prime number.
